§ 12:7C-3 — Redemption

At any time prior to the sale, any flat-bottomed boat, barge, scow or raft seized and forfeited to a municipality in accord with section 2 of this act, may be redeemed by the owner thereof, or other person entitled thereto upon payment to the municipality of an amount equal to the actual expense incurred by the municipality in removing such vessel and placing it in a boat storage basin plus 6% interest, or an amount equal to $10.00 per day for every day from the date of forfeiture, whichever is the greater. L.1969, c. 264, s. 3, eff. Jan. 9, 1970.
